I’m looking for a very simple crop recording package. I want to record what happens in each field and then allocate the costs such as chemical, seed and establishment harvest etc. I don’t want it cloud based and it won’t connect to our agronomist as he’s old school paper based. I’m not spreadsheet literate so can’t throw anything together myself. Budget probably £250 or thereabouts.

What level of compliance information can it hold? Looks quite simplistic from their website...can you do LERAP, tank mix instructions, water volumes, stock?
no - but the OP didn't ask for that..."very simple crop recording" is exactly what field margin is. If you want everything else you've described there is nothing to beat gatekeeper at present.

Fieldmargin have just added inputs to the software... looking a serious contender to gatekeeper.

Thanks @farmerfred86 - we are adding the features we get asked for the most and our users (in 80 countries now) needed a lightweight way to plan and keep track of input usage. So we've launched the first version of that. We have in app reporting and we're adding a CSV download for the excel-fans too.

Tank mixes and water usage can be handled already (add water as an input) and we are making job sheets printable for those who don't want to work from their phone. In conjunction with the all-you-can-eat NDVI mapping we are confident that people can make better decisions in season.
